Title
On the improvement of WirelessHART Access Points by means of Software Defined Radio

Abstract
WirelessHART (WH) is a recently standardized wireless fieldbus. The connection between WH and the host plant network is obtained with Access Points and Gateways. These devices have complex (and costly) architecture, but do not offer flexibility with respect to new update of the specification, and have limited diagnostic capabilities. In this paper, the architecture of a smart WH Access Point, which takes advantage of the Software Defined Radio paradigm, is presented. Thanks to its extreme flexibility and adaptability, it can provide a good investment protection. Moreover, it has additional diagnostic features, like interfering protocol identification and decoding, that keep the network reliable and available. As proof of concept, a prototype of the proposed WH Access Point has been developed using GNU Radio, obtaining the first simulation results.
